Any idea when Hibs first started programmes?

Only two Scottish Cup Final Replay programmes ever printed, Morton v Rangers in 1948 and Celtic v. Rangers in 1963. If you have the 1948 one it is worth around £1,000.

Also (and this is true) Hibs produced a binder of home programmes in the late 40s which I have seen with my own eyes, think they did it 2/3 times, must be worth an absolute fortune now.

Bound volumes were produced from 49/50 to 61/2 except 55/6 season for some reason. 49/50 to 54/5 are valuable because they included all 4 page reserve and single sheet third team issues. Some BVs have appeared in the past on eBay, but not seen one for a few years.
